GTRD (Gene Transcription Regulation Database) is a database of transcription factor binding sites identified from ChIP-seq experiments. GTRD analyze freely avalable ChIP-seq experiments from literature, GEO, SRA and ENCODE databases.

Database statistics

GTRD uses 2417 ChIP-seq experiments for 470 distinct sequence specific transcription factors.

Most of ChIP-seq experiments (1638) have corresponding control experiment.

General statistics:

Object type Total count Per ChIP-seq experiment
ChIP-seq reads 80.808E9 34.937E6
Read alignments 58.848E9 25.675E6
ChIP-seq peaks 59.515E6 32899

In average each transcription factor is measured in 4.07 ChIP-seq experiments, but 284 (60%) transcription factors measured only in one experiment.

The ten most studied transcription factors listed bellow:

Transcription Factor Number of ChIP-seq experiments
CTCF 195
c-Myc 45
ERα 44
NRSF 37
C/EBPβ 37
GATA-1 33
NF-κB p65 30
Max 30
PU.1 29
GR 24


Database structure

The metadata concerning GTRD is stored in MySQL tables.

Each ChIP-seq experiment has a row in 'chip_experiments' table, which assigns id and stores basic information about experiment. 'chip_experiments' table has following structure:

Column Description Example value
id Unique experiment identifier EXP000489
antibody Antibody used in chromatin immunoprecipitation sc-345
tfClassId Id in TFClass[1] database of target transcription factor, NULL for control experiments 6.2.1.0.1
cell_line Studied cell line HeLa S3
specie Specie latin name Homo sapiens
treatment Cell treatment or conditions IFN gamma
control_id Id of control experiment, NULL for control experiments or experiments without control EXP000490

The links to external databases stored in 'external_refs' table:

Column Description Example values
id Experiment identifier EXP000489
external_db External database name GEO or PUBMED or ENCODE or SRA
external_db_id Identifier in external database GSM320736
